OK I have been helped her before. My non-turbo 740 was belching black smoke a while back and I was able to remedy things by cleaning up the contacts at the air mass meter. At least I thought I had. The last few days the symptoms are appearing again and my fix is not working this time. Where can I be looking next.

Check the vacuum hose at the fuel pressure regulator. If it has fuel in it, replace the regulator.

Replacing my O2 sensor fixed that problem for me.
